Transaction 04fedb0beb814c52ba229e80a897a593065713835596767f93121c7e5296ef81

1 Input
2 Outputs
  • 04fedb0beb814c52ba229e80a897a593065713835596767f93121c7e5296ef81:0
  • value  1843468000000
    address  1AoKHLDgKiJ6oiAGC4THZqq8CjjLLHKyFj
  • 04fedb0beb814c52ba229e80a897a593065713835596767f93121c7e5296ef81:1
  • value  100000000000
    address  1D3WbrJkG7rdeZ8RFLfmmnZtFoGFnt2xi